Output 88fa7d68caf943cbae96eb3f32ecb187acd51ca35ac76a595ea16eaf528f7eaa:0

value
2924920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c125b70f7b3eda2a8b70e2e724e54246be51656e OP_EQUAL
address
3KJHX4F4naxZaBiPUHNTVqg2ofqdv3DQP7
transaction
88fa7d68caf943cbae96eb3f32ecb187acd51ca35ac76a595ea16eaf528f7eaa
spent
true